Fullstack Developer

Details of the offer

We're looking for a driven Software Developer who is dedicated to their personal and professional growth. Join our passionate team, where you'll have the opportunity to make a meaningful impact and gain exposure across diverse industries. We're seeking a candidate eager to develop leadership skills and advance into a leadership role over time. If you're committed to continuous learning and ready to contribute to our shared success, we'd love to hear from you.
Primary Duties and Responsibilities: Contribute to all stages of the development lifecycle.Write efficient, testable code.Ensure designs meet specifications.Prepare and release software components.Interest and/or experience in leading a team to deliver high-quality results.Required Qualifications: Tertiary degree, diploma or certificate in a related field (BSc Computer Science, B.IT or Informatics related degrees) with over 3 years of experience as a Software Developer.
Experience and Knowledge: Strong understanding of development methodologies and frameworks.Working experience as a Software Developer.Knowledge of test-driven development and unit testing beneficial.Experience with public cloud and containerization is an advantage.Familiarity with DevOps is a plus.Development Activities: Contribute to all phases of the development lifecycle.Ensure designs are in compliance with specifications.Prepare and produce releases of software components.Technologies and Tools: Knowledge of SOLID principles, object-oriented design, and design patterns.Expertise in .NET Core with C#, .NET Web API, SQL Database Design, Entity Framework Core, SQL Server 2014+, T-SQL.Critical thinking and problem-solving.Active learning and systems analysis.Deductive and inductive reasoning.High technical literacy and analytical skills.Must be able to work within a close-knit team.Candidates with an interest in developing leadership skills.Needs to be able to work independently.Moyo Culture and Values: We make a difference.We've got your back.We are leaders.We are reliable.We are brave.Our company provides equal employment opportunities to all.

#J-18808-Ljbffr


Nominal Salary: To be agreed

Source: Jobleads

Requirements

Operations Administrator – Entry Level. Full Training Provided – 19023 Ref: 19023

Are you looking for the first stepping stone of your career? Perhaps you have some previous admin experience and want a fresh new opportunity with a team tha...


Recruitment Revolution - Gauteng

Published a month ago

Software Engineer

A company specializing in card, payments, network billing, and data. Utilizing sophisticated algorithms and technology, analyzing Visa and MasterCard invoice...


Capital Recruit - Gauteng

Published a month ago

Desktop Support Technician

Are you passionate about providing exceptional IT support to clients? Do you thrive in a fast-paced environment where your technical expertise makes a real d...


Capital Recruit - Gauteng

Published a month ago

Front End Developer (Mid-Senior Level)

Front End Developer (Mid-Senior Level) Job Description We are seeking a highly skilled and experienced Software Engineer to join our dynamic team. The ideal ...


Capital Recruit - Gauteng

Published a month ago

Built at: 2024-11-14T07:04:57.713Z